Ghana’s Black Queens are facing off with Morocco’s Atlas Lionesses in an international friendly on February 21, at the Père Jégo Stadium in Casablanca.

This match marks the beginning of a new era under the leadership of new head coach Kim Lars Björkegren. It also serves as the team’s first game since July 2024, when they faced Japan.

The Black Queens have been actively preparing for the encounter in Morocco, training intensively with their new coaching staff.

Over the past few days, Björkegren has been working closely with his assistants, Sampson Charles and Anita Wiredu, to fine-tune the squad.

This game will provide Björkegren with a valuable opportunity to assess his new team and evaluate their prospects ahead of the Women’s Africa Cup of Nations later this year.
